Analysis: As Omicron Piles on Economic Fears, Canadian Outlook Offers Glimmer of Bland Optimism

In an economic analysis, the CBC says that while Omicron has caused the stock market to stumble, new data on the Canadian economy is expected to be “reassuringly bland.” New reports say that there are increasing signs that the Omicron variant is “just more of the same.” The Wall Street Journal reports that "Investors [are] betting that the impact of the omicron COVID-19 variant will be less profound than initially feared.” While recent data on Canada’s economic growth is “healthy,” CBC reports that it is also “bland enough to avoid sparking new inflationary fears” regarding the Omicron variant.
